Well it all depends on what are you comparing it to? Compared to western countries the Former Yugoslav Republic of Macedonia is quite poor. It used to be the poorest part of Former Yugoslavia. Salaries are higher in the capital Skopje about 500-600 euros/month and much lower in the rest of the country about 250 euros/month.
